ANWAR ALI VS State Ss. 9(a)(v) & 14(c)---Assets beyond known sources of income---Presumption---Onus to prove---Accused is always presumed to be innocent and onus of proving commission of offence and guilt of accused lies on prosecution---Exception has been provided under National Accountability Ordinance, 1999 to such rule and has been provided in S. 14(c) of National Accountability Ordinance, 1999---Notwithstanding presumption contained in S. 14(c) of National Accountability Ordinance, 1999, initial burden of proof always rests on prosecution---Burden to prove all ingredients of charge always lies on prosecution and it never shifts on accused, who can stand on plea of innocence assigned to him under law till it is dislodged---Prosecution is never absolved from proving charge beyond reasonable doubt and burden shifts to accused only when prosecution succeeds in establishing presumption of guilt.
